Linux 笔记 - 第二十三章 MySQL 主从复制配置
摘要:一、前言 MySQL Replication,也被称为主从复制、AB 复制。简单来说就是 A 和 B 两台服务器做主从后,在 A 服务器上写入数据,B 服务器上也会跟着写入输入,两者之间的数据是实时同步的。主从复制技术主要用来提供实时备份或读写分离服务。 MySQL 主从是基于 binlog 的,主
阅读全文
posted @
2019-10-13 15:03
沐小悠
阅读(452)
推荐(0) 编辑
Linux 笔记 - 第十六章 LNMP 之(一) 环境搭建
摘要:博客地址:http://www.moonxy.com 一、前言 LNMP 中的 N 指 Nginx,在静态页面的处理上,Nginx 较 Apache 更胜一筹;但在动态页面的处理上,Nginx 并不比 Apache 有优势,目前有很多爱好者对 Nginx 比较热衷。 二、安装 LNMP LNMP 中
阅读全文
posted @
2018-08-14 22:40
沐小悠
阅读(592)
推荐(0) 编辑
Linux 笔记 - 第十五章 MySQL 常用操作和 phpMyAdmin
摘要:博客地址:http://www.moonxy.com 一、前言 前面几章介绍了 MySQL 的安装和简单的配置,只会这些还不够,作为 Linux 系统管理员,我们还需要掌握一些基本的操作,以满足日常管理工作所需。MySQL环境中的命令需要带一个分号作为命令结束符。 MySQL 之父 Widenius
阅读全文
posted @
2018-08-05 14:47
沐小悠
阅读(856)
推荐(0) 编辑
Linux 笔记 - 第十四章 LAMP 之(二) 环境配置
摘要:博客地址:http://www.moonxy.com 一、前言 LAMP 环境搭建好之后,其实仅仅是安装上了软件,我们还需要掌握 httpd 和 PHP 的配置。 二、httpd 配置 2.1 创建虚拟主机 我们以搭建 discuz 论坛为例,介绍如何在 Apache 中创建虚拟主机。 下载 dis
阅读全文
posted @
2018-07-28 20:38
沐小悠
阅读(953)
推荐(0) 编辑
Linux 笔记 - 第十四章 LAMP 之(一) 环境搭建
摘要:博客地址:http://www.moonxy.com 一、前言 LAMP 是 Linux Apache MySQL PHP 的简写,即把 Apache、MySQL 以及 PHP 安装在 Linux 系统上,组成一个环境来运行 PHP 脚本语言,通常是 PHP 的网站。其中的 Apache 是主流的
阅读全文
posted @
2018-07-21 16:37
沐小悠
阅读(594)
推荐(0) 编辑
Linux 笔记 - 第十三章 Linux 系统日常管理之(四)Linux 中 rsync 工具和网络配置
摘要:博客地址:http://www.moonxy.com 一、前言 rsync 命令是一个远程数据同步工具,可通过 LAN/WAN 快速同步多台主机间的文件,可以理解为 remote sync(远程同步)。rsync 使用所谓的 "rsync算法" 来使本地和远程两个主机之间的文件达到同步,这个算法只传
阅读全文
posted @
2018-07-14 23:07
沐小悠
阅读(495)
推荐(0) 编辑
Linux 笔记 - 第十三章 Linux 系统日常管理之(三)Linux 系统日志和服务
摘要:博客地址:http://www.moonxy.com 一、前言 日志文件记录了系统每天发生的各种各样的事情,比如监测系统状况、排查问题等。作为系统运维人员可以通过日志来检查错误发生的原因,或者受到攻击时攻击者留下的痕迹。日志的主要功能是审计和监测,还可以实时地监测系统状态、监测和追踪侵入者等等。 二
阅读全文
posted @
2018-07-12 22:46
沐小悠
阅读(2332)
推荐(0) 编辑
Linux 笔记 - 第十三章 Linux 系统日常管理之(二)Linux 防火墙和任务计划
摘要:博客地址:http://www.moonxy.com 一、前言 Linux 下的的防火墙功能是非常丰富的,作为 Linux 系统工程师有必要了解一下。防火墙一般分为硬件防火墙和软件防火墙。但是,不管是硬件还是软件防火墙,它们都需要使用硬件来作为联机介质,也需要使用软件来设定安全规则。 二、Linux
阅读全文
posted @
2018-07-08 22:38
沐小悠
阅读(421)
推荐(0) 编辑
Linux 笔记 - 第十三章 Linux 系统日常管理之(一)系统状态监控
摘要:博客地址:http://www.moonxy.com 一、前言 如果你是一名 Linux 运维人员,最主要的工作是优化系统配置,使应用在系统上以最优的状态运行。系统运行状态主要包括:系统负载、内存状态、进程状态、CPU 负载等信息。 二、监控系统的状态 监控系统的状态主要包括系统负载和 CPU 的使
阅读全文
posted @
2018-05-23 21:59
沐小悠
阅读(714)
推荐(1) 编辑
Linux、Windows 和 Mac 中的换行符对比
摘要:原文地址:Linux、Windows 和 Mac 中的换行符对比 博客地址:http://www.moonxy.com 一、前言 经常使用 Window、Linux 等不同操作系统的开发者,在处理文本的时候,基本都会遇到不同系统,出现换行格式不一致的问题,原因就出在不同的系统,定义了不同的换行符。
阅读全文
posted @
2018-04-22 20:58
沐小悠
阅读(24849)
推荐(3) 编辑
Linux 笔记 - 第十二章 Shell 脚本
摘要:博客地址:http://www.moonxy.com 一、前言 常见的编程语言分为两类:一类是编译型语言,如:C、C++ 和 Java等,它们远行前要经过编译器的编译。另一类是解释型语言,不需要编译,执行时,需要使用解释器一行一行地解释执行,如:awk、perl、python 和 shell 等。
阅读全文
posted @
2018-04-16 21:40
沐小悠
阅读(578)
推荐(0) 编辑
Linux 笔记 - 第十一章 正则表达式
摘要:博客地址:http://www.moonxy.com 一、前言 正则表达式(英语为 Regular Expression,在代码中常简写为 regex、regexp 或 RE),是使用单个字符串来描述或匹配一系列符合某个句法规则的字符串。许多工具和程序设计语言都支持利用正则表达式进行字符串操作,在
阅读全文
posted @
2018-04-05 17:18
沐小悠
阅读(818)
推荐(0) 编辑
Linux 笔记 - 第十章 Shell 基础知识
摘要:博客地址:http://www.moonxy.com 一、前言 Shell 是系统的用户界面,提供了用户与内核进行交互操作的一种接口,它接收用户输入的命令并把它送入内核去执行。实际上 Shell 是一个命令解释器,它解释由用户输入的命令并且把它们送到内核。不仅如此,Shell 有自己的编程语言用于对
阅读全文
posted @
2018-04-02 22:08
沐小悠
阅读(533)
推荐(0) 编辑
Linux 笔记 - 第九章 Linux 中软件的安装
摘要:博客地址:http://www.moonxy.com 一、前言 在 Linux 系统中,应用程序的软件包主要分为两种:1)第一种是二进制的可执行软件包,也就是解开包后就可以直接运行。在 Windows 中几乎所有的软件包都是这种类型,类似于 exe ,安装完这个程序后就可以使用,但你看不到源代码,而
阅读全文
posted @
2018-03-28 21:55
沐小悠
阅读(836)
推荐(0) 编辑
Linux 笔记 - 第七章 Vi 和 Vim 编辑器
摘要:博客地址:http://www.moonxy.com 一、前言 Vi 与 Vim 都是多模式编辑器,是 Linux 中必不可少的工具。不同的是 Vim 是 Vi 的升级版本,它不仅兼容 Vi 的所有命令,Vi 使用于文本编辑,但是 Vim 更适用于 Coding。不仅如此,Vim 还有一些新的特性在
阅读全文
posted @
2018-03-28 21:54
沐小悠
阅读(292)
推荐(0) 编辑
Linux 笔记 - 第八章 文档的打包与压缩
摘要:博客地址:http://www.moonxy.com 一、前言 在 Linux 系统中,文件的后缀名没有实际的意义,加或者不加都无所谓。但是为了便于区分,我们习惯在定义文件名时加一个后缀名,比如常见的归档文件 .gz,归档压缩文件 .tar.gz 等,特别对于压缩文件,最好加上后缀名,这样方便判断压
阅读全文
posted @
2018-03-28 21:54
沐小悠
阅读(557)
推荐(0) 编辑
Linux 笔记 - 第六章 Linux 磁盘管理
摘要:博客地址:http://www.moonxy.com 一、前言 1.1 硬盘 硬盘一般分为 IDE 硬盘、SCSI 硬盘和 SATA 硬盘。在 Linux 中,IDE 接口的设备被称为 hd,SCSI 和 SATA 接口的设备则被称为 sd。第一块 硬盘被称作 sda,第2块被称作 sdb,以此类推
阅读全文
posted @
2018-03-28 21:53
沐小悠
阅读(893)
推荐(0) 编辑
Linux 笔记 - 特殊权限
摘要:博客地址:http://www.moonxy.com 一、前言 Linux 中使用权限的时候,一般都是使用 3 位数,比如,777、755、666、644 等,其实在最前面还有一位,那就是特殊权限,也就是 set uid、set gid 和 sticky bit。 二、特殊权限 setuid:设置使
阅读全文
posted @
2018-03-05 22:22
沐小悠
阅读(317)
推荐(0) 编辑
查看 Linux 系统版本信息
摘要:博客地址:http://www.moonxy.com 一、前言 Linux 下如何查看内核信息、发行版信息,系统位数、CPU 信息等等,Windows 下我们可以通过各种图形化软件来查看,但是对于 Linux,我们需要使用相应的命令来获取这些信息。 二、查看系统信息 2.1 查看 Linux 内核版
阅读全文
posted @
2018-03-04 18:47
沐小悠
阅读(1478)
推荐(0) 编辑
Linux 中 Xampp 的 https 安全证书配置
摘要:博客地址:http://www.moonxy.com 一、前言 HTTP 协议是不加密传输数据的,也就是用户跟你的网站之间传递数据有可能在途中被截获,破解传递的真实内容,所以使用不加密的 HTTP 的网站是不太安全的。在一些对安全性要求较高的网站,比如银行、证券、购物等,都采用 HTTPS 服务,这
阅读全文
posted @
2018-03-02 00:10
沐小悠
阅读(4722)
推荐(1) 编辑